2018-12-03 Spiders at Pasir Ris Mangroves - zenyee
Log In
Support
Home
Browse
Search
a thousand of words through the lens ... a statement from my eyes
A Bug's Life
2018-12-03 Spiders at Pasir Ris Mangroves
Read More
Buy Photos
Buy Photo
This Photo
Photos from This Gallery
Buy Photo Package
Buy Gallery Download
Build a Book